Output bd8416594f8905e511546829b92cb5c54f2f5f2cae9e4752114a19ef51b2e9b3:1

value
43493384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55ef893d068e54b0f69f621231592393a288dbba OP_EQUAL
address
MFjYczf7NdQ5SLZfSSESGyPDSN5UFEwqNL
transaction
bd8416594f8905e511546829b92cb5c54f2f5f2cae9e4752114a19ef51b2e9b3
spent
true